I have taken both the Savoring France and the Douro tours; the former in Apr/May and latter in Nov. Weather was perfect both times.
Terrilynn, we did the Douro in late Oct/early Nov. We did avoid heat in places like Lisbon and Spain and the colors were lovely. But we had rainy days on the river, very little chance to enjoy the newly designed sun deck and our welcome dinner at the Queluz Palace started after dark so we didn't see the garden. If I was planning it again I'd opt for a week or 2 earlier in Oct.
